> Try using the latest version from svn.  macholib doesn't create 
> anything, it only makes small transforms to existing files, so there 
> aren't any architecture options... but it does need to understand how to 
> read and write universal binaries in order to make those transforms.  
> The version you're using doesn't understand them very well.
